Eli Lilly and Company Foundation
The Eli Lilly and Company Foundation is a private, corporate foundation established in 1968 and supported by donations from Eli Lilly and Company, a pharmaceutical manufacturing company headquartered in Indianapolis, Indiana. The foundation operates as a tax-exempt 501(c)(3) organization with the primary mission of extending Eli Lilly's charitable reach and impact through strategic philanthropic investments.

Mission & Focus Areas
The foundation supports programs designed to improve patient outcomes and enhance quality of life, with special emphasis on:
- Global Health: Improving healthcare for people living in communities with limited resources, with a focus on low and middle-income countries
- Education: Strengthening public education with emphasis on science and math (STEM) education, particularly for children in underserved communities in Indianapolis
- Community Development: Supporting charitable community development and cultural organizations, with particular focus on Indianapolis and Central Indiana
- Economic Mobility & Equity: Supporting initiatives and projects that address barriers to equitable access and opportunities
- Employee Engagement: Matching employee and retiree donations and recognizing volunteer service

How to Apply
The foundation does not accept unsolicited proposals and does not provide direct contact for grant inquiries.

Geographic Focus
Where this funder awards grants
The foundation directs more than half of its grants to Indianapolis and Central Indiana, where Eli Lilly is headquartered. The foundation also supports global health initiatives in low and middle-income countries and has additional funding activity in California and North Carolina.

Recent News & Activity
Recent developments and announcements
The foundation has demonstrated significant commitment to STEM education in Indianapolis, including a multi-year grant of $5.5 million to the Indianapolis Public Schools Foundation to support transformative STEM education programs. The foundation also provided $500,000 in grants to support equitable access to education for Dreamers in Indiana and awarded $750,000 to the MV3 Foundation as part of a new partnership.
